| Has anyone experienced any problems with electrical power to the Dashboard during very cold weather. When you start the car, it will run, but then very shortly, the fan will cut out, the rpm dial will keep jumping from 0 and the actual RPM, the radio dies, and the display will only show the service required icon. The fan will cycle on and off and if you try to drive the dial will not show your speed. In about 10 min or so, the vehicle will warm up abit and full power will be restored. | |
